2. Is digital signature legal?
Yes, it is completely legal. After ESIGN Act released in 2000, an e-signature is considered legal, just like physical one is. You are able to fill out a writable document and sign it, and to official institutions it will be the same as if you signed a hard copy with pen, old-fashioned.
